University of Maryland researchers develop smart underwear to track flatulence
Researchers have developed a first-of-its-kind smart underwear designed to non-invasively track human flatulence. The wearable device features a small disc that snaps into the underwear, utilizing tiny electrochemical sensors to detect hydrogen released by the gut microbiome.
Led by Brantley Hall of the University of Maryland, the project aims to provide more accurate data than traditional self-reporting or uncomfortable rectal tubes. By monitoring gas production, scientists hope to gain insights into human metabolism, digestive health, and how different diets affect the gut. The data collected contributes to the ‘Human Flatus Atlas,’ a global research project.
A study involving nearly 60 participants, published in the journal Biosensors and Bioelectronics, found that healthy adults produced an average of 32 gas events per day, significantly higher than the 14 daily events typically cited in medical literature. While not currently a medical device, the technology could eventually help identify triggers for digestive conditions such as food intolerance and irritable bowel syndrome.
